sulfurized

[ˈsʌlfjəraɪzd]

sulfurized Definition

  • 1treated or combined with sulfur or a sulfur compound
  • 2to treat or combine with sulfur or a sulfur compound

Summary: sulfurized in Brief

'Sulfurized' [ˈsʌlfjəraɪzd] is an adjective or verb that refers to the treatment or combination of a substance with sulfur or a sulfur compound. This process is commonly used to increase the durability or resistance to corrosion of materials such as rubber or metal. Sulfurized oils are also used in the production of lubricants and fuel additives.
